READ BACKGROUND CONTEXT TO FILM: In 1947 the 7th Marques of Londonderry left the Plas mansion and its ground to the District Council of Machynlleth for "the perpetual use and enjoyment of the inhabitants of this town and district". But since the 'Celtica' visitor centre closed in March, the building has been standing empty and largely unused. The Council invited organisations and groups to submit proposals for the future use of the building. One such proposal, put together by the 'Plas Steering Group' grew out of extensive surveys and consultations with the local community and enjoys widespread popular support. But it was subsequently leaked that the County Council felt that it would be within its rights to sell the building privately should this be the most financially attractive option. This film was made to give the Council an idea of the breadth of support and enthusiasm for the community proposal and the sense of loss that would be felt if the Plas building were to be sold privately. It is edited entirely of footage shot on the 25th of June, at an event designed to give the community the opportunity to explore the local proposal and offer feedback. Residents of the town and district were invited to speak to the camera in our "Big Other Diary Room" about their hopes for the future of the building. To date (Dec 2006) the Council still have not reached a decision about the future of the Plas Building.For more information about the Plas Steering Group's proposal see www.plasmachynlleth.org.uk
